Abstract :
The main constructing methods of metro tunnel include shield tunneling method (TBM) and mining method. The quality of the tunnel constructed by mining method is less stable than by TBM. Various faults may occur during the construction. The tunnel should be inspected by reliable inspecting methods. The inspecting practices in Shenzhen metro indicate that ground penetrating radar (GPR) can be used to exactly inspect the thickness of the second lining, the rebar distribution within the second lining, the dense of the second lining concrete, the cave distribution behind the second lining and so on.
